Water Circulation and Maintenance

Efficient water circulation is essential for keeping a backyard fountain in pristine condition. Routine maintenance ensures longevity and optimal performance of this low-maintenance water feature.

Pump Installation

The pump plays a crucial role in any water fountain, ensuring constant water flow. Selecting the right pump involves considering the fountain’s size and design. Submersible pumps are often recommended due to their quiet operation and efficiency. Positioning the pump at the base of the fountain provides stable water circulation. Ensuring the pump is free from debris and obstructions is vital for its continued function.

Regular inspection of the pump’s parts, such as the impeller, avoids potential issues. Using a mesh bag or filter around the pump can minimize debris buildup.

Maintaining a Clean and Functional Fountain

To maintain a fountain, routine cleaning is important. Algae growth can be prevented by placing the fountain in a shaded area and using non-toxic algaecides. Removing leaves and dirt prevents clogging and helps maintain a low-maintenance water feature. Changing the water every few weeks is another good practice to keep it clean.

Checking the water level regularly is essential to prevent the pump from running dry. If limescale build-up occurs, cleaning with a vinegar solution can help.

Innovative Water Features Without a Pond

Innovative water features can enhance outdoor areas without requiring a pond. These options offer elegance and tranquility, making them ideal for small spaces or those seeking low-maintenance.

Disappearing Water Fountain

A disappearing water fountain, often called a recirculating fountain, is a clever solution for those who want the sound of flowing water without a visible basin. The water seems to vanish as it flows through a grate into an underground reservoir, where a pump recycles it back to the top. This feature provides a clean and streamlined look.

Installation involves digging a shallow basin into the ground and setting up a pump. With the water source concealed, this fountain is not only aesthetically pleasing but also safer for homes with children or pets. Maintenance is minimal, requiring only periodic cleaning of the pump and storage area. These features blend well with any garden or patio décor and require no direct water line.

DIY Pondless Water Feature

A pondless water feature offers serenity without the complexity of a traditional pond. This feature uses rocks, gravel, or other decorative elements to allow water to flow into a hidden reservoir. The absence of a pond makes it easier to install, even for beginners.

Creating a DIY pondless water feature involves selecting and arranging decorative stones to form a natural pathway for the water. The installation process is straightforward—digging a reservoir, setting up a pump, and placing the stones ensure reliability and functionality. These installations can adapt to various styles, allowing individuals to customize their spaces while enjoying the soothing sounds of water without the need for extensive maintenance.
